Nearly every bad agency story starts the same way. A huge first month, a promise that it only goes up from there, and a page that never gets back to where it was.

What actually happens in a squeeze

Every conversation becomes a sale attempt, whether he joined today or two years ago. Fans get pushed on price, pushed on volume, pushed on urgency, and promised things nobody intends to deliver. Some of them buy, once. The spike looks incredible on a screenshot. Six weeks later the people who felt used have stopped opening messages, and the ones who would have spent for two years are gone.

What we do instead

We build the relationship first and let the spending follow it. Nothing gets promised that is not coming, so a fan never finds out later that he was played. Sometimes that still produces a very large first month, and our results page has the screenshots. What it reliably produces is a better sixth month, and a handful of fans who genuinely stay and end up worth more than everyone else combined.

The number that matters is not what a page made in month one. It is whether it is still making that in month twelve, and whether the fans from month one are the ones saying so.

Why it matters

What consistent actually buys you.

01

A number you can plan around

Rent, savings, whatever you are building toward. That only works if the page pays roughly the same every month. One enormous month followed by four quiet ones is not an income, it is a lottery ticket.

02

Fans who renew without thinking

A fan who feels looked after resubscribes on autopilot. Retention is most of the money on any page and almost nobody optimises for it, because it does not show up in a first month screenshot.

03

A name that holds up

Fans talk to each other and so do creators. What gets said about your page when you are not in the room is what decides how the next year goes, and it is built one honest conversation at a time.

What we hold to

Four things we do not bend on.

Not a poster on a wall. These are the four rules everything above is built out of, and every one of them costs us something, which is the only reason they are worth writing down.

HONESTY

Nothing gets promised that is not coming

A fan is told what he is actually getting, every single time. It closes fewer sales this week. It is also the only reason a page is still earning the same a year later, and the only reason anyone says anything good about you when you are not in the room.

TRANSPARENCY

You can check everything

Chat sales, how each chatter is performing, real conversation examples from your own page, whenever you ask. If something is not working we would rather you saw it early than found out months later from your own numbers.

FREEDOM

You can leave any day

No minimum term, no notice period, no approval needed from us. An agency that has to trap you to keep you has already told you exactly what it thinks its work is worth.

PATIENCE

Consistent beats big

We will not take the month that looks incredible on a screenshot if it costs the next eleven. The number we care about is whether the page is still making that in month twelve, with the same people paying it.
